Title COMPARATIVE STUDY OF MIPV4 AND MIPV6 REAL-TIME TRAFFIC PERFORMANCE OVER DIFFERENT CORE TECHNOLOGIES
Authors Mr. Ahmad Talaat, Ain Shams University, Cairo, Egypt
Dr. Hussein A. Elsayed, Ain Shams University, Cairo, Egypt
Prof. Hadia El Hennawy, Ain Shams University, Cairo, Egypt
Abstract One of the major performance aspects to be monitored in any core network is the end-to-end delay. This depends on the end-to-end IP technology used rather IPv4 or IPv6; also it will be changed in case of using mobile IP. This paper focuses on real-time traffic performance under different core network technologies. From the end user operation point of view; core network technology is transparent with respect to the end user mobile protocol. Using MIPv4 and MIPv6 will be studied on IP backbone and ATM backbone; also using IPv4 backbone to support MIPv6 via tunneling is covered here.
